Paul Darrow gets it right in his interview though: when you are The Hero there are things you cannot do (that in real life would have you dead) but the sidekick can. That is what made it; restriction to 5 people there was scope to be a 'type' but at the same time see how that type operates in all circumstances. Star Trek only needs 'types' because there's a crew of umpteen hundred nonentities for the donkey work. In Blakes7 everybody must be everything as their character would handle it.
